const ViceSerializeVersion = 51
Version history 0-7 not explicitly recorded 8: STARSPane DCB improvements, added DCB font size control 9: correct STARSColors, so update brightness settings to compensate 10: stop being clever about JSON encoding Waypoint arrays to strings 11: expedite, intercept localizer, fix airspace serialization 12: set 0 DCB brightness to 50 (WAR not setting a default for it) 13: update departure handling for multi-controllers (and rename some members) 14: Aircraft ArrivalHandoffController -> WaypointHandoffController 15: audio engine rewrite 16: cleared/assigned alt for departures, minor nav changes 17: weather intensity default bool 18: STARS ATPA 19: runway waypoints now per-airport 20: "stars_config" and various scenario fields moved there, plus STARSFacilityAdaptation 21: STARS DCB drawing changes, so system list positions changed 22: draw points using triangles, remove some CommandBuffer commands 23: video map format update 24: packages, audio to platform, flight plan processing 25: remove ArrivalGroup/Index from Aircraft 26: make allow_long_scratchpad a single bool 27: rework prefs, videomaps 28: new departure flow 29: TFR cache 30: video map improvements 31: audio squelch for pilot readback 32: VFRs, custom spcs, pilot reported altitude, ... 33: VFRs v2 34: sim/server refactor, signon flow 35: VFRRunways in sim.State, METAR Wind struct changes 36: STARS center representation changes 37: rework STARS flight plan (et al) 38: rework STARS flight plan (et al) ongoing 39: speech v0.1 40: clean up what's transmitted server->client at initial connect/spawn, gob->msgpack 41: sim.State.SimStartTime 42: server.NewSimRequest.StartTime 43: WX rework (scrape, etc.) 44: store pane instances and split positions separately, rather than the entire DisplayNode hierarchy 45: Change STARSFacilityAdaptation to FacilityAdaptation 46: Remove token from video map fetch RPC, misc wx updates 47: pass PrimaryAirport to GetAtmosGrid RPC 48: release bump 49: STARS consolidation 50: rework State/StateUpdate management 51: preemptive before v0.13.3 release

func LoadScenarioGroups ¶
func LoadScenarioGroups(extraScenarioFilename string, extraVideoMapFilename string, e *util.ErrorLogger, lg *log.Logger) (map[string]map[string]*scenarioGroup, map[string]map[string]*ScenarioCatalog, map[string]*sim.VideoMapManifest, string)
LoadScenarioGroups loads all of the available scenarios, both from the scenarios/ directory in the source code distribution as well as, optionally, a scenario file provided on the command line. It doesn't try to do any sort of meaningful error handling but it does try to continue on in the presence of errors; all errors will be printed and the program will exit if there are any. We'd rather force any errors due to invalid scenario definitions to be fixed...
Returns: scenarioGroups, catalogs, mapManifests, extraScenarioErrors If the extra scenario file has errors, they are returned in extraScenarioErrors and that scenario is not loaded, but execution continues.

type VoiceAssigner ¶ added in v0.13.3
type VoiceAssigner struct {
// contains filtered or unexported fields
}
VoiceAssigner manages the pool of available TTS voices and assigns them to aircraft callsigns. Each aircraft gets a consistent voice throughout the session.
func NewVoiceAssigner ¶ added in v0.13.3
func NewVoiceAssigner() *VoiceAssigner
NewVoiceAssigner creates a new VoiceAssigner.
func (*VoiceAssigner) GetVoice ¶ added in v0.13.3
func (va *VoiceAssigner) GetVoice(callsign av.ADSBCallsign) (sim.Voice, bool)
GetVoice returns the voice assigned to an aircraft, assigning one if needed. Returns empty string and false if no voices are available yet.
func (*VoiceAssigner) TryInit ¶ added in v0.13.3
func (va *VoiceAssigner) TryInit(tts sim.TTSProvider, lg *log.Logger) bool
TryInit attempts non-blocking initialization of the voice pool from the TTS provider. Returns true if the pool is ready for use.
